Punjab & Sind Bank Login: Internet Banking Steps
Follow these steps to log in to your Punjab & Sind Bank Internet Banking account:
-
Visit the official Punjab & Sind Bank website.
-
Click on the Internet Banking Login option.
-
Select Retail User or Corporate User.
-
Enter your User ID and Password.
-
Complete the CAPTCHA verification.
-
Click Login to access your account.
Once logged in, you can manage all your banking services online.
How to Register for Punjab & Sind Bank Internet Banking
If you are a new user, you must register first:
-
Go to the Punjab & Sind Bank official website.
-
Click on New User Registration.
-
Enter your Account Number, Registered Mobile Number, and Date of Birth.
-
Verify using the OTP sent to your mobile number.
-
Create a User ID and Password.
-
Submit the form to complete registration.
After successful registration, you can log in using your new credentials.

Forgot Punjab & Sind Bank Login Password?
If you forget your password, follow these steps:
-
Click on Forgot Password on the login page.
-
Enter your User ID and Registered Mobile Number.
-
Verify the OTP sent to your mobile.
-
Set a new password.
-
Log in using the updated credentials.
